In a small town where book clubs flourish, a mother-daughter duo finds themselves navigating the complexities of growing up and growing closer. Megan, a teenager who would much prefer a shopping day over discussing classic literature, is drawn into the world of the Mother-Daughter Book Club. The club promises more than just discussions on books; it becomes a space for connection, laughter, and deeper understanding amid the whirlwind of adolescence.
As the women delve into varied literary works, from feisty heroines to timeless tales, they unearth hidden secrets and learn valuable life lessons. Cassidy, a devoted participant, champions the idea that books can strengthen the bonds between mothers and daughters. Throughout their journey, each member faces personal challenges that test their relationships, ultimately leading to heartwarming revelations about love, friendship, and the significance of sharing stories together.
